Unlike many slow-release foliar nitrogen options, the L-amino acids in Amino15™ are absorbed directly by the leaf and converted into proteins with minimal plant energy or water required. This rapid uptake is particularly valuable during reproductive phases. While approximately 65% of a corn plant’s nitrogen needs are accumulated by the tasseling stage, the remaining 35% is demanded between the VT and R6 growth stages. Leaf absorption during this high-demand window efficiently supplies nitrogen right as the plant shifts its resources toward pollination, kernel set, and grain fill.
Application, pH, and Droplet Advantages
The sugarcane molasses in all QLF L-CBF products acts as a natural humectant, slowing the drying of spray droplets on the leaf surface. This extends the window for nutrient absorption and prevents droplet evaporation during airtime, ensuring maximum plant contact. Furthermore, Amino15™ delivers surfactant-like properties that improve droplet uniformity, maximize coverage, and reduce drift. This makes it an ideal partner for lower-rate aerial applications—whether by airplane, helicopter, or drone—where the straight product handles remarkably well as the sole carrier of the solution with no added water. Amino15™ also provides a naturally low, acidic pH range of approximately 4.5 to 5.5. This acidic environment offers two distinct benefits:
- Preserves Tank Mix Stability: It helps maintain the chemical half-life of many common fungicides, which perform best and degrade more slowly in mildly acidic conditions.
- Enhances Cuticle Penetration: The lower pH aids in breaching the leaf cuticle, improving the overall uptake of both nutrients and crop protection products.
A Season of Resilience: 2025 On-Farm Trials
The 2025 growing season brought exceptionally tough conditions across Central Iowa and the wider Midwest. Southern rust hit early and hard, leaving crops severely stressed. Despite these challenges, two aerial on-farm trials that integrated Amino15™ into growers’ standard fungicide programs demonstrated outstanding resilience and economic return.

- Application: 3 gal/ac of L-CBF Amino15™ + fungicide applied at the VT stage via drone.
- Results: Delivered +14.6 bu/ac over the grower’s standard program, resulting in a $50.62 net return per acre.

- Application: 2 gal/ac of L-CBF Amino15™ + fungicide applied via helicopter across multiple fields (149.9 acres treated out of a 303.6-acre trial).
- Results: Produced strong, consistent yield gains across variable terrain, yielding an average $57.60 net return per acre.
These local results directly align with data from the Precision Technology Institute (PTI) Farm in Pontiac, Illinois (Trial APP854). A 3-year study evaluating Amino15™ with fungicide at the VT stage showed remarkable consistency across varying weather conditions, averaging +8.83 bu/ac and a $27.72 return on investment year after year.
